Know your rights and responsibilities under COBRA and HIPAA.  Within 90 days after you enroll in University benefits, notices explaining your rights and responsibilities under the Consolidated Omnibus Budget Reconciliation Act of 1996 (COBRA) and the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act of 1996 (HIPAA) will be mailed to your home.  COBRA allows you and/or your dependents to continue certain benefits at your own expense if you and/or your dependent(s) become ineligible for these benefits due to termination or change in appointment or dependent status (for more information on current COBRA benefit rates, click here).  HIPAA provides, among other things, restrictions on the way your personal health information is collected, used and disclosed.  The related notice mailed to your home will describe the University's compliance with HIPAA's privacy protections or click here to view the notice.  We encourage you to carefully review both notices.
